Transaction 3a7164675e7ceabe4257bdba101c3968df2a00bb2b7a1774e649a186a7c3229e

1 Input
2 Outputs
  • 3a7164675e7ceabe4257bdba101c3968df2a00bb2b7a1774e649a186a7c3229e:0
  • value  1248180
    address  3H2htYpnpz5kktvRGEnimtH3GZ3yMw51Ue
  • 3a7164675e7ceabe4257bdba101c3968df2a00bb2b7a1774e649a186a7c3229e:1
  • value  16773035
    address  15JFdR1gaPcPM5ERZaytnYVCFh5anz5oZ1